I don't know why everone thinks you need some large hall to warrent buying the M80's.I have mine in a room thats 20x15 and 7.5 foot high by far not a large room.I had no problems with placement.They are not as hard to place as everyone thinks they are.If you can afford to buy them I suggest give it a go,you won't be sorry.The only down side I could see is you can't push them with a reciever that can't handle a 4 ohm load.The HK could do it with no problems.One thing is for sure with the M80's you will never wonder what if.
